The Newfoundland and Labrador English School District will be holding a recruitment fair on Tuesday in western Labrador at Menihek High School for bus drivers and school custodians.

The District is currently seeking applications for general interviews. On-site interviews will be conducted. Training will be provided with salaries starting at $20.05 per hour and a competitive benefits package.

Langford Elementary School Draws Inspiration from Tree House DesignAn elementary school under construction in Langford is taking inspiration from tree house design to address the vertical focus of the building. The four-storey school, located on a sloped site, will be tucked into a forested area and offer sweeping views. The $39.6-million school is set to open in September 2025 and will accommodate 480 students in 20 classrooms. It will also feature a neighbourhood learning centre and child-care spaces.

Ontario Elementary School Teachers Union Files Complaint Against GovernmentThe Elementary Teachers' Federation of Ontario has filed a complaint with the province's labour relations board, accusing the government of violating bargaining obligations by issuing new requirements related to reading screenings. The union argues that the government's actions do not demonstrate good faith in ongoing negotiations for a new collective agreement.

Bruce Jago, Founding Executive Director of Goodman School of Mines, Passes Away at 66Bruce Jago, the founding executive director of Laurentian University’s renowned Goodman School of Mines in Sudbury, has died at the age of 66. Jago, a respected exploration geologist with over 30 years of experience in the mining industry, was known for his expertise as an 'industry insider.' He leaves behind his wife, children, and many family and friends. A celebration of life will be held on August 10, 2023.
